Charlemagne is a versatile genetic programming application. It includes a commandline client and an interactive console mode. It is written in Python and Lisp, and is user extensible to some degree in both languages. It features built-in input-output mapping support and provides the ability to define complex fitness calculations in Lisp or Python.

Release Notes: This release adds an interactive console mode, much-improved documentation, and a standardized Python distutils-based installation, and lays the groundwork for future enhancements such as GUI-based configurators and visualizers. The commandline interface still exists and integrates smoothly into the interactive mode.
